Levitate West
A native Las Vegan, Dodson says that his paintings and prints are a depiction of a realm just outside our own, where the network of desert flora throughout Southern Nevada interact in a way that aligns with the neural connections of the human brain. This ancient floral language is the underlying pulse of the artwork. He hopes that his artwork will provide the viewer the experience of an altered state of consciousness: a feeling of levitating through space, time, and the Southwest Desert.

DREAMERS OF DREAMS
An exhibit highlighting emerging artists, Chala Escobar, D.B., and Jesus Orozco. In celebration of Black History Month, 2023, Meow Wolf collaborated with Left of Center Art Gallery to represent African and African American culture and heritage. LOC Gallery emerging artists, live painted a custom mural inside Omega Mart in 6 hours under the direction of veteran LOC artists and professional designers, Adolfo Gonzalez and Harold Bradford. The mural is their interpretation of the past and the future co-existing and the community that has gathered to make Left of Center Gallery a place many call home. The mural will be on display during the exhibition run. We see these young artists as our future, the dreamers of dreams which lie ahead. We are proud of the work they have done and the beauty they are bringing to the world.
